Output 8671ce8af15a6ba204f5c580fd28f24a4a792928fe1b8be58ce0f7036e73f22c:0

value
533388
script pubkey
OP_0 OP_PUSHBYTES_20 e34480e83ae4bb08ddf5a07a14b2536c514652e2
address
bc1qudzgp6p6ujas3h045papfvjnd3g5v5hzhduu7x
transaction
8671ce8af15a6ba204f5c580fd28f24a4a792928fe1b8be58ce0f7036e73f22c
spent
true